Description of key information

In accordance with column 2 of REACH Annex IX, the soil simulation test does not need to be conducted as the substance is readily biodegradable.

Additional information

Because of ready biodegradability of LAS-MIPA in water, no study into biodegradation of LAS-MIPA in soil is required.

The biodegradation of LAS-MIPA may be further described by the biodegradation of LAS-Na and MIPA according to the read-across statement in which full dissociation of the LAS-MIPA in water is supported. For the soil compartment this is relevant for indirect applications via sludge application.

For MIPA no study on biodegradation in soil was available.

Half-life in sludge-amended soil after application of sludge of LAS-Na was >7 -<22 days based on recovered LAS-Na.
